Bar di Bello brings Milanese design and cuisine to Silver Lake
Bar di Bello, a new Italian eatery in Los Angeles's Silver Lake neighborhood, opened in the Sunset Row complex. The restaurant was designed by Dean Levin of 22RE, drawing inspiration from Milanese landmarks like La Scala and LA institutions such as Musso & Frank and Giorgio Baldi. The interior features red travertine, walnut millwork, Afra and Tobia Scarpa sconces, and Vico Magistretti chairs. The menu includes modern Milanese dishes like trofie alla Genovese and breaded chicken cutlet with shallot soubise. The wine list, curated by partner Kristin Olszewski, mixes California and Italian labels. Bar di Bello is located at 3300 Sunset Blvd., Los Angeles.
